taking my TP on my first vacation

Just got back from a business trip and wanted to post a couple frustrations I have had. I had to constantly plug my phone in during the day due to heavy use. I would absolutley with out a doubt recoomend a backup battery if you know your going to be out and not in an office all day (i work from home so never had to deal with this before). Second, although the TP has great features it is not a laptop replacement. I thought I would be cool by not bringing my laptop but heavy use DRAINS the battery way to fast, and then you dont have a phone, bring a laptop. FInally the music player. I only have the stock 1 gb card so not a ton of room but it did well. When i had the phone in airplane mode it had battery life that i thought i was going to have all along (first smartphone). To use it for exptended period of time again drainsthe battery, going to go buy a dedicated mp3 player this week. Finally streaming music DRAINS the battery, my phone would get so damn hot it was annoying, Orb and kinoma are so awesome but not useful for long term playing.

I hope this saves some one some pain on not having a phone due to a dead battery. Speaking of battery/store shoudl i get one at?
